Abstract

 This research aims to create a framework to guide the development of design thinking support tools - that is, tools that enable people to express themselves creatively and develop as creative thinkers. The main goal is to develop advanced software and social networking sites that empower users to not only be productive, but also have new technologies. Potential users of these interfaces include software with other engineers, various scientists, product and image designers, builders, teachers, students and many more. Improved communication methods can enable effective psychological search, improved interaction between groups, and faster recovery processes. These advanced combinations should also provide strong support for hypothesis formation, rapid testing of alternatives, improved visual perception, and better distribution of results.
